Toni Street is a New Zealand broadcaster and national treasure who has been a regular on television and radio for over a decade. Toni kept the country up to date with sport and current events while she reported for or presented Seven Sharp,  Breakfast and One News. While we do miss seeing her smiling face, we are very pleased we get to hear her cheery voice every week-morning on The Hits radio station with her co-hosts Sam Wallace and Laura McGoldrick. She is also Mum to two gorgeous girls, MacKenzie and Juliette and their delicious baby brother Lachie.  

Toni chats to Art and Matilda about her journey into broadcasting and how she navigates the silver screen and radio with the nation watching her every move. She opens up about her battle with Churg-Strauss syndrome, a life-threatening auto-immune disease that she is now in remission from. Toni also shares her strategy for staying healthy while working and looking after her beautiful family. Hint; F45 you have a big fan! Toni explains the benefits of a program like F45 and how taking the guesswork out of her exercise and eating has made her life so much easier.
